Marywood vs. Ship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Marywood or Ship?

  • Marywood University is 293.9% more expensive to attend than Ship for in-state tuition ($37,700.00 vs. $9,570.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 225.7% higher at Marywood than Shippensburg University of Pennsylvania ($37,700.00 vs. $11,574.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Shippensburg University of Pennsylvania than Marywood ($23,344 vs. $24,712)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Shippensburg University of Pennsylvania are 16.6% lower than costs at Marywood University ($12,952 vs. $15,100)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Marywood University than Shippensburg University of Pennsylvania (100% vs. 85%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Marywood University students is 368.4% larger than aid received Shippensburg University of Pennsylvania ($27,875 vs. $5,951)

Marywood vs. Ship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Marywood or Ship?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Ship and Marywood.

  • The graduation rate at Marywood is higher than Shippensburg University of Pennsylvania (62% vs. 60%)
  • Graduates from Shippensburg University of Pennsylvania earn on average $6,100 more per year than Marywood graduates after ten years. ($47,200 vs. $41,100)
  • Shippensburg University of Pennsylvania students graduate with a $2,000 lower median federal student loan debt than Marywood graduates. ($25,000 vs. $27,000)
  • Ship graduates are paying $21 less per month on federal student loans than Marywood graduates. ($258 vs. $279)
  • More Ship gra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Marywood students, three years after graduation. (72% vs. 70%)
